An Australian porn star has spoken out about the excruciating moment he broke his penis live on set.

Liam Ellis was in the throes of passion on set with one woman and another man when the incident happened.

Speaking to Daily Mail Australia, he said: “Basically I was having sex at the time… and it slipped out and I was still in motion and I wasn’t lined up.

“That caused my penis to bend and tear, resulting in a penile fracture.”

While Ellis said it didn’t hurt at the time, the damage soon reared its ugly head.

“My penis swelled up straight away and after a few hours it went black from bruising,” he explained.

Ellis had to undergo surgery to correct the workplace incident and is now back on the mend, although he is understandably concerned he “might never be the same again”.

“I’m worried it might be one of those things that once you do it, it might happen again,” he said.

Ellis went on to reveal he plans on being “cautious” in the bedroom moving forward, before revealing the one positive thing to come out of the life-changing experience.

“I got a free circumcision out of it, which is something I’ve always wanted,” he said.

According to NHS figures, the sex-related injury isn’t as uncommon as you might think.

Stats show the number of surgeries on people who have injured their penis during sex is up by 37 per cent year-0n-year.

Professionals had to fix a whopping 169 fractured todgers in the year up to last April – 46 more than the same period the year before.

Experts are scratching their heads over why the sudden increase might have occurred, with some saying it could be a result of more men using Viagra to up their chances of performing.

The majority of procedures are being carried out on men in their 30s, even though two people in their 70s also had painful problems last year.

To fix the penis it has to be cut to enable medics to stitch the tear.

According to London-based consultant urologist Gordon Muir, such breaks can take place during romps when the penis comes out but gets bent when it attempts to re-insert.

He said this can commonly happen when the woman is in an “on top” position.
